Unterlinden Museum

The Unterlinden Museum original location in the 13th century convent is now linked to the former municipal baths building inaugurated in 1906. The architects Herzog & de Meuron connected the two buildings and added a contemporary extension. An underground gallery con-sisting of three exhibition rooms passes underneath the Place Unterlinden and the canal. It leads to the new building, the Ackerhof, which is named after the convent’s former farm building. More than ever before, the Musée Unterlinden has room to display its encyclopaedic collections. Visitors can also enjoy spaces including the cloister garden, the museum orchard, the Café, the shop…
